Expense and Makeover Timeline

Average Renovation Pricing in WA

Most affordable landscape renovation projects in Maple Valley range from $5,000 to $20,000, depending on scope and materials. Small updates like mulching, lighting, or minor planting may cost under $3,000, while full-yard transformations with outdoor patio construction and drainage work can exceed $30,000. Factors like site access, grading needs, and King County permits influence final pricing. A detailed bid breaks down every cost so you can plan wisely.

Estimated Timeline from Start to Finish

From consultation to completion, most yard transformation services take 4 to 12 weeks. Simple renovations like planting and mulching wrap up in 1–2 weeks, while complex builds with deck and paver work or drainage systems may stretch into months. Permit approval, weather delays, and material availability can affect scheduling. A reliable firm provides a clear project calendar and updates you at every milestone.

Navigating King County Rules

King County Landscaping Guidelines

Prior to breaking ground on your garden redesign, it’s critical to understand King County permits and local codes that oversee outdoor construction. From outdoor patio construction to retaining wall installation over 3 feet, many landscape renovation projects require county-issued authorization to ensure public and environmental safety.

Protected Species and Permitting

Taking down certain trees in Maple Valley requires permits—even on private property—due to King County’s erosion control ordinances. Size, species, location, and health all factor into whether a tree qualifies as protected, especially for mature evergreens.

Neighborhood Association Rules

When you live in a community governed by an HOA, your landscape renovation may need written approval before work begins. Rules often cover materials, fencing height, lighting placement, and even plant types to preserve neighborhood aesthetics and property values.
